Heartbreak, Healing and Hang Ups with Shan Boodram and Dora Kamau
This episode is an exclusive behind-the-scenes look at all things Hung Up. Shan is talking to Dora Kamau, one of Headspace’s superstar meditation guides who does her own work around healing after a break-up… Dora and Shan dig into all things heartbreak, healing and hang-ups.

Amazing. So, I'm curious because for a lot of people, talking about breakups is like the scariest thing to do. So what sparked your interest in learning more about breakups and closure and relationships? For lack of better term, shit experiences and trying to make sense of those myself. I naturally was somebody who was very drawn to the human body growing up, obviously coming from a Caribbean household, also, I went to a Catholic school, that natural interest wasn't encouraged. So I watched a lot of porn growing up. I watched a lot of fiction TV shows, try to inform myself because I didn't feel there was a safe space for me to ask questions without being judged for my curiosity. As I got older, that enthusiasm, mixed in with misinformation, led to a lot of really negative experiences.
